Common Issues and Errors Related to CNMSM8U.DLL
DLL files often play a critical role in system operations. Despite their importance, these files can sometimes source system errors. Below we consider some of the most frequently encountered faults associated with DLL files.
- This application failed to start because CNMSM8U.DLL was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.
- CNMSM8U.DLL Access Violation: The error signifies that an operation attempted to access a protected portion of memory associated with the CNMSM8U.DLL. This could happen due to improper coding, software incompatibilities, or memory-related issues.
- Cannot register CNMSM8U.DLL: This error is indicative of the system's inability to correctly register the DLL file. This might occur due to issues with the Windows Registry or because the DLL file itself is corrupt or improperly installed.
- CNMSM8U.DLL not found: The system failed to locate the necessary DLL file for execution. The file might have been deleted or misplaced.
- CNMSM8U.DLL could not be loaded: This error indicates that the DLL file, necessary for certain operations, couldn't be loaded by the system. Potential causes might include missing DLL files, DLL files that are not properly registered in the system, or conflicts with other software.

Update Your Device Drivers
In this guide, we outline the steps necessary to update the device drivers on your system.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Device Managerin the search bar and press Enter.
-
In the Device Manager window, locate the device whose driver you want to update.
-
Click on the arrow or plus sign next to the device category to expand it.
-
Right-click on the device and select Update driver.
-
In the next window, select Search automatically for updated driver software.
-
Follow the prompts to install the driver update.
